Is Cala Deià worth visiting if I want an easy beach day in Mallorca?
It suits people who like rocky coves, not those looking for a simple sandy beach day.
Does Cala Deià have sand or is it mostly rocks?
Cala Deià is mostly rocky, not sandy.
Is Cala Deià suitable for families with small children?
It is not a very family-friendly beach because of the rocks, heat and difficult access.
How hard is it to park at Cala Deià in Mallorca?
Parking is limited, and many visitors must walk down from above Deià.
What is the best time to visit Cala Deià to avoid the crowds?
Go early if you want fewer people and less stress with parking.
Can you swim safely at Cala Deià?
Yes, but the rocky entrance means you need to be careful.
What should I pack for Cala Deià in Mallorca?
Pack shoes, water, sun protection and something that works on rocks.
